I bought the LG A9K cordless stick vacuum without doing much research, and I seriously regret it. Despite using it lightly for just one year, the vacuum constantly loses suction power and frequently switches into self-protection mode, stopping mid-use.

I took it to the authorized service center, and they simply cleaned it and sent it back. But only a month later, the exact same issue returned. Clearly, this isn’t a cleaning problem—it’s a design or hardware flaw.

I chose LG thinking it was a quality brand, but I now see that for this price, I could’ve easily bought a Dyson and avoided all this frustration. The vacuum is now basically unusable, and I’m beyond disappointed. I’m requesting a replacement unit from LG. A product with such frequent issues under light use shouldn't be failing this soon.
